The '''Swordslayer''' (Japanese: {{ | The '''Swordslayer''' (Japanese: {{hl|ソードキラー|Sōdokirā}} ''Swordkiller'') is a weapon introduced in {{FE3}} which at different points in the {{FES}} has been a [[sword]] and an [[axe]]. In both forms it performs the same role, as a weapon which is [[Bonus damage|highly effective]] against sword-wielding infantry classes such as the [[Mercenary]] and [[Myrmidon]]. As an axe in the [[Game Boy Advance]] games it also reverses the [[weapon triangle]], making it strong against swords and weak against [[lance]]s, and doubles the weapon triangle's effects. | ||
